I believe it's about 8k for the S650. Prochargers prices for painting their products black is ridiculous. I believe it about 295 for a black centrifuge mount. And 325 for the centrifuge. ESS black finish is cheaper.I've had a Procharger kit on my 2018 for 3.5 years now and would buy one again in a heartbeat . . . . if it didn't cost $10,000.00, plus install, plus remote tuning.
ESS kits are in the mid 5K to low 6K range for the S550, plus install, plus remote tuning as well.
Price for the ESS will probably be higher for the S650, but I doubt it will jump to 10K.

What people like to call the nostril.Intake location will most likely be just like the S550, drawing inlet air from the inner fender well.
IAT's on my 2018 set up like this are 3 - 5 degrees above ambient all the time.
Stock inlet system on the 650 runs much hotter.
I was on the .com earlier. Makes no reference to post 2023 Mustang. Plus the company is in Norway.723 whp on pump 93 with a completely stock S650. Just the addition of the ESS kit.
Note the huge increase in torque down low, from around 150 ft. lbs. under 3K to over 300 ft. lbs. under 3K, with the ESS kit. That's some serious kick in the pants in the lower range.
723 whp is eclipsing a 6th Gen, stock GT500.
